3D Reconstruction Technology Market Growing at 9.33% CAGR Through 2035

The 3D Reconstruction Technology Market Size is witnessing consistent growth as industries increasingly adopt advanced imaging and modeling solutions to create accurate digital representations of real-world objects and environments. The market is valued at USD 1.55 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 3.78 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 9.33% during the forecast period 2026–2035.

3D reconstruction technology involves capturing the shape and appearance of real objects using techniques such as photogrammetry, LiDAR, and depth sensing, and converting them into detailed 3D models. These models are widely used across industries including construction, healthcare, gaming, manufacturing, and robotics.

Rising Adoption in AR/VR and Gaming

The increasing use of aug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) is a key driver of the 3D reconstruction technology market. High-quality 3D models are essential for creating immersive virtual environments and interactive experiences.

Gaming and entertainment industries leverage 3D reconstruction to enhance realism, enabling more engaging and visually rich content for users.

Growing Use in Construction and Infrastructure

3D reconstruction technology is gaining traction in construction and infrastructure projects for site mapping, building modeling, and project visualization. It enables accurate measurement, planning, and monitoring, improving efficiency and reducing errors.

Real-time 3D modeling also supports better collaboration among stakeholders, enhancing project outcomes.

Expansion in Healthcare Applications

In healthcare, 3D reconstruction is used for medical imaging, surgical planning, and diagnostics. Technologies such as CT scans and MRI leverage 3D reconstruction to provide detailed anatomical models, improving precision in treatment and procedures.

This capability is particularly valuable in complex surgeries and personalized medicine.

Advancements in LiDAR and Photogrammetry

Technological advancements in LiDAR and photogrammetry are significantly improving the accuracy and speed of 3D reconstruction. These technologies enable the capture of high-resolution spatial data, making them suitable for applications in autonomous vehicles, robotics, and industrial inspection.

Continuous innovation is making these solutions more accessible and cost-effective, further driving market adoption.

Increasing Demand in Industrial and Manufacturing Sectors

Industries such as automotive and manufacturing are using 3D reconstruction for quality inspection, reverse engineering, and product design. The ability to create precise digital replicas helps improve production processes and reduce time-to-market.

Automation and integration with AI are further enhancing the capabilities of 3D reconstruction systems.

Regional Insights

North America dominated the 3D Reconstruction Technology Market in 2025, accounting for approximately 38.45% of the global revenue share. This leadership is driven by the high adoption of AR/VR technologies, robotics, and industrial inspection solutions.

The United States and Canada are at the forefront of adopting advanced technologies such as LiDAR and photogrammetry across industries including automotive, healthcare, and construction. These technologies are widely used for applications ranging from autonomous navigation to medical imaging.

The region benefits from strong digital infrastructure, a highly skilled workforce, and early adoption of cutting-edge innovations. Increasing enterprise investment in real-time 3D modeling and visualization further strengthens North America’s market position.

Future Outlook

The 3D Reconstruction Technology Market is expected to grow steadily as demand for accurate digital modeling and visualization increases across industries. Emerging trends such as AI-powered reconstruction, real-time 3D mapping, and integration with digital twins will shape the future of the market.

As industries continue to embrace automation and data-driven decision-making, 3D reconstruction technology will play a crucial role in enhancing efficiency, precision, and innovation.

With the market projected to grow from USD 1.55 billion in 2025 to USD 3.78 billion by 2035, 3D reconstruction is set to become a foundational technology in the evolution of digital and physical convergence.
